The Basics of Diatomaceous Earth and Its Function in Water Filtering



Diatomaceous planet, a naturally happening, soft sedimentary rock, plays a critical role in water purification systems. Composed primarily of the fossilized remains of diatoms, small marine organisms, it possesses a highly porous framework. This one-of-a-kind structure allows it to serve as a natural filter, trapping contaminations consisting of germs, infections, and natural pollutants while allowing water to travel through.




In water filtration, diatomaceous planet is typically used in a powder form and included in a filtration system. As water moves with the powder, the great pores of diatomaceous planet capture bits a lot smaller sized than the eye can see, properly detoxifying the water. This method is prized for its efficiency and natural origin, making it a favored option in both commercial and household setups. In addition, it is environmentally friendly, requiring minimal processing and being stemmed from an eco-friendly resource, thereby adding to lasting water monitoring practices.

How does diatomaceous planet contrast to other water purification methods? Diatomaceous planet (DE) sticks out due to its unique microstructure, which is composed of fossilized remains of diatoms. These microscopic skeletons have little pores that trap contaminations, including infections and bacteria, making DE specifically effective in getting rid of fine bits from water. Unlike turned on carbon filters, which mainly get rid of organic substances and improve preference and odor, DE purification can capture smaller sized fragments without the requirement for chemical ingredients.




Various other common filtering techniques, such as reverse osmosis (RO) and ultraviolet (UV) light, vary considerably from DE. RO systems are understood for their capacity to demineralize water and remove essentially all impurities, yet they are frequently extra energy-intensive and call for more maintenance. Enhancing Pool Upkeep With Diatomaceous Planet Filtration





Several pool owners are turning to diatomaceous planet (DE) purification systems to enhance their maintenance routines - diatomaceous earth water filtration. This all-natural filter tool, made from fossilized remains of tiny water microorganisms, offers exceptional filtering capabilities compared to conventional sand or cartridge filters. DE filters can catch particles as small as 3 to 5 microns, significantly boosting water clearness and reducing the visibility of impurities
